How much do production associate j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 22, 2026, the average hourly pay for production associate in Boscobel, WI is $16.86,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$14.47 and $18.32 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a production associate?

Production Associates are entry-level workers who assist in the manufacturing process within factories or production facilities. Their responsibilities typically include assembling products, operating machinery, monitoring production lines, and ensuring quality standards are met. They may also be responsible for packaging, labeling, and basic maintenance of equipment. Production Associates play a crucial role in maintaining efficient workflow and supporting higher-level technicians or supervisors. The role often requires attention to detail, manual dexterity, and the ability to follow safety protocols.

What does a production associate do?

A production associate’s job duties depend on the industry in which they work. If you’re a manufacturing production associate, then your responsibilities include maintaining production equipment and assemblies, ensuring quality control, overseeing manufacturing personnel, ordering materials, monitoring packaging and shipping of the product, and handling clerical tasks like work orders and documentation. As a production associate in the film and TV industry, your duties include hiring and scheduling actors and technical staff, resolving technical challenges such as equipment failure, and maintaining relationships with suppliers and vendors.

What is the difference between Production Associate vs Manufacturing Technician?

AspectProduction AssociateManufacturing Technician
Required CredentialsHigh school diploma or equivalent; on-the-job trainingHigh school diploma; technical certifications or vocational training often preferred
Work EnvironmentFactories, assembly lines, production floorsManufacturing plants, quality control labs, equipment maintenance areas
Employer & Industry UsageManufacturing, assembly, packaging industriesManufacturing, industrial production, equipment maintenance sectors
Common Search & Comparison IntentUnderstanding entry-level manufacturing rolesTechnical skills and equipment operation in manufacturing

The main difference between a Production Associate and a Manufacturing Technician lies in their responsibilities and skill requirements. Production Associates typically perform basic assembly and packaging tasks with minimal technical training, while Manufacturing Technicians handle equipment maintenance, troubleshooting, and more technical duties. Both roles are essential in manufacturing environments, but Manufacturing Technicians usually require additional technical certifications or vocational training.

Cummins Inc., headquartered in Columbus, IN, US, is a global power leader that designs, manufactures, and distributes numerous power products and systems. With its genesis from as early as 1919, the company readily serves diverse industries such as transportation, industrial, generator drive, or marine applications, among others. At the heart of Cummins' operations, its key product lineup encompasses diesel & natural gas engines, generator sets, engine components, and filtration, emission solutions, and electrical power generation systems.
